Ekahau Inc, Saratoga, Calif, a provider of Wi-Fi-based real-time location systems (RTLS), has introduced the Ekahau positioning engine (EPE) 4.2, which helps improve the solution’s ability to deliver standards-based location accuracy, speed, and savings to the Wi-Fi-based RTLS market and application developers.

The product is the foundation of the company’s RTLS, a turnkey system that can be installed over any brand or generation of Wi-Fi infrastructure. The RTLS provides a software solution that supports location tracking with room-level or better accuracy using the existing Wi-Fi network. It does not require additional chokepoints, UWB antennas, or other proprietary infrastructure.

The company has incorporrated new features such as added event management, better scalability, and faster deployment. The positioning engine’s HTTP API allows it to be used as a development platform for RTLS application development and ERP integration.
